Starting pitchers Tyler Glasnow and Blake Snell had throwing sessions Friday that went well, lending optimism to a Los Angeles Dodgers\' staff battered by injuries.
Glasnow threw two innings in a simulated game at Dodger Stadium, where the NL West-leading Dodgers opened a three-game series against the second-place San Francisco Giants.
\"I thought the stuff was really good,\" manager Dave Roberts said. \"The velocity was there, the swing-and-miss, the delivery. Talking to him afterward, he was really excited.\"
